This is the documentation for the latest (main) development branch of Zephyr. If you are looking for the documentation of previous releases, use the drop-down menu on the left and select the desired version.

CONFIG_ENTROPY_STM32_ISR_POOL_SIZE

ISR-mode random number pool size

Type: int

Help

Buffer length in bytes used to store entropy bytes generated by the
hardware to make them ready for ISR consumers.
Please note, that size of the pool must be a power of 2.

Direct dependencies

ENTROPY_STM32_RNG && ENTROPY_GENERATOR

(Includes any dependencies from ifs and menus.)

Default

  • 16

Kconfig definition

At drivers/entropy/Kconfig.stm32:40

Included via Kconfig:8Kconfig.zephyr:40drivers/Kconfig:30drivers/entropy/Kconfig:15

Menu path: (Top) → Device Drivers → Entropy Drivers → STM32 RNG driver

config ENTROPY_STM32_ISR_POOL_SIZE
    int "ISR-mode random number pool size"
    range ENTROPY_STM32_ISR_THRESHOLD 256
    default 16
    depends on ENTROPY_STM32_RNG && ENTROPY_GENERATOR
    help
      Buffer length in bytes used to store entropy bytes generated by the
      hardware to make them ready for ISR consumers.
      Please note, that size of the pool must be a power of 2.

(The ‘depends on’ condition includes propagated dependencies from ifs and menus.)